Yeah, for that price you could get MSD 6AL and Summit spiral core wires with some AC plugs. Why soak all that money into an inductive dischage ignition when you could get a CD box for the same money.

CD box - 170
Wires - 32

Get a good MSD coil to match, might as well get the cap too.

$50 for platinum 4's? What a gimmick.

MSD cap and rotor, MSD coil, MSD wires, Holley ignition module, and forget about wasting money on any other plug besides good old AC Delco. Not like you're going to want to leave the platinums in for 100,000 miles, and longevity is their only advantage aside from their tendency to cause autoignition in performance engines (If you like knock). A spark is a spark. I haven't had too much luck with all my Accel stuff. Just my $0.02.
